Stereograph of ruins in Woodstock, near Pitkin in Gunnison County, Colorado, taken in 1884 by George E. Mellen following an avalanche that destroyed the town in March of that year. The image shows the side of a collapsed one-story building leaning insecurely against a wooden plank. Snow covers the part of the collapsed roof and debris from the collapse is scattered around the foreground. In the background evergreen trees extend from the top left corner to the middle of the right side. This image pairs with accession number 84.192.1644, which shows workers outside the ruined building. Woodstock is today a ghost town.
